SAN JOSE, Calif. (KGO) -- Crews are working to repair a large pothole in San Jose Friday morning.

Officials said the 4-foot wide hole opened up on Tully Road and Kenesta Way.

Officials said one lane is closed at this time and crews are currently at the scene trying to patch it up.

It doesn't seem to be very deep.

Officials said there is no word yet on when the giant pothole will be fixed, so if you're in area you may want to take an alternate route.
